Sun nihara

  • 合計アクティビティ 26
  • 前回のアクティビティ
  • メンバー登録日
  • フォロー 0ユーザー
  • フォロワー 0ユーザー
  • 投票 0
  • サブスクリプション 10

コメント

Sun niharaによる最近のアクティビティ 最近のアクティビティ 投票
  • mnさんすいません通知見落としてました>この時の削除フラグはメインソースの項目ですか?YESです!DBとか件数とか環境状況にもよりますが、タスクの範囲式は遅いことが多いのとクロスリファレンスにかかりづらいのでnkmtさんお仰る方法がおすすめですよ

  • 例えば、明細の一覧で削除済みを表示するチェックボックスを作ってチェック入れた時にのみ削除フラグ=1の行も表示するとした場合親タスクに明細の範囲式を制御する変数を作ってそれで表示非表示の制御チェックボックスがついたら親のフラグ更新してビュー再表示するていうことをよくやりますでも最近は、RangeAddという関数が増えているのでそれを使ってみるのもよいかと思いますあまり使ったことないのでヘルプを...

  • だいずさん、お返事ありがとうございます、フォームを生成していそうなんですか・・magicのテーブルじゃないんでしょうかね、.net のDatatableコントロール貼ってるとかだとそのプロパティを変えればよいかとは思いますが、ちょっとMAGICだけだとどうやってるか想像つきませんねー!Tandaさんご教示ありがとうございます、フォーム状態の維持は存じておりましてリセットというよりはマウスで動...

  • 他のプログラムではゴリゴリと再計算していると書いてらっしゃったので何か種も仕掛けもない.netとかで直接magicのテーブルを読み込み、操作していたりするのでしょうか?後学のために差しさわりのない範囲でご教示いただけないかと思っておりますーよくリクエストはもらうんですが無理っすねーて断ってるので・・・

  • 画面を開きなおさずにということであれば難しいのではないでしょうか開きなおしてもいいならFormStateClearとかフォーム状態の維持のプロパティとかで対応できるとおもいますが・・・

  • Tandaさん、そうなんですね、あまりそこまで困る件数の取り扱いがないのですが確かにコンバートとかでテキストファイルぐるぐる読んだりしたときあまり早くはないですねそうなると件数が多い時は直接DBに書き込むかーってなりますけどそれはそれで汎用性が低いので悩ましいですね

  • Tandaさんありがとうございます、データ量が多いとCSVにしてしまうのもありですね!逆側が関数1個でポンっとできるので何かよいブレイクスルーはないかと思案しております

  • SQL経由なら定義取得でワンチャンいけるかな、とか思いましたけどどちみちDDF見ながらテーブルリポジトリ打ち直すくらいしかないんじゃないでしょうか

  • 大体合わないところは押さえてらっしゃるのではないでしょうか、あと重複可不可、プライマリキーくらいしかうっかり変更してもうて、何が違うのかさっぱりわからないときはいったん物理ファイルリネームして新しく作った後、PSQL Maintenanceで定義内容見比べたりPSQL Control CenterでDDFつくって、サイズいれてズレてないか見てたりしますわたしはよく凡ミスするのでそこまで合わな...

  • 読みだすだけなら作り方で大分早さが変わってきますねただ集計するときはSQLの方が早くって、月毎の集計テーブル作るときはプロシージャちょっとした集計が欲しい時は、保守性は最悪ですがSQL生成するサブプロを作って流してとるようなことをしていたりSQLコマンドSELECT :1    FROM :2 :3 引数1 'MAX(' & VarDbname('A'var) & ')'引数2 DSOURC...